OurofficeislocatedinmidtownBeijing.LANGUAGEPOINTS–TEXTA什么是创业公司?创业公司是指仍处于运营初期的刚刚开业或起步的公司。这些公司的成立是为了满足需求或解决以前从未解决过的问题。虽然它们通常以最少的资金和较小的团队起步,但它们可以迅速扩大规模或发展壮大。它们的目的是利用技术跨越时间和空间,向巨大的市场提供产品或服务。这意味着它们的市场不受特定地点或时区的限制,它们可以向上海和伦敦不同时区的人销售产品。这使得它们能够快速增长,在短时间内实现一倍甚至两倍的收入。在生存和成长的道路上,他们需要考虑以下4个方面。集资创业者最初可以从朋友和家人那里获得资金,但他们也可以从投资者或风险投资公司获得资金。与提供贷款或赠款的银行不同,风险投资家(VC)可以更多地参与初创企业的运营。他们可以监督业务并提供建议。对于一家刚刚起步的新公司,有专家或更有经验的人的指导和监督是至关重要的。商业模式除了资金,创业公司还需要一个商业模式或商业计划。商业计划可以确定公司的使命或愿景:他们计划实现什么以及他们计划解决哪些需求。它还可以列出具体的目标和公司为实现这些目标可以采取的策略。此外,创业公司还需要进行市场调查,以确定他们计划提供的产品或服务是否有市场,以及这些客户是谁。营销策略营销策略可以帮助初创公司更快地接触到客户,让客户了解公司以及公司可以提供什么服务。他们可以通过电子邮件(电子邮件营销)或创建社交媒体页面来发布服务和促销信息,从而接触客户。选址创业公司需要考虑的另一件重要事情是其办公室的位置。这很大程度上取决于其想要提供的产品或服务的类型。例如,一些生产电子产品的初创企业通常需要一个实体店,顾客可以顺便来店里试用产品。而另一些提供服务的公司则只在网上提供服务。后者更具成本效益,因为维护网站和在线展示比租用实体空间更便宜。虽然创办一家新公司并不容易,但只要在合适的地方拥有合适的资金、商业模式和营销策略,就能迅速扩张或壮大。TextA译文UNITTASKAStep1
